• Добрый день.
    В инете в основном рассмотрен 1 способ:
    Откройте файл functions.php и добавьте в него такой код:

    //html в комментариях start
    function plc_comment_post( $incoming_comment ) {
    	$incoming_comment['comment_content'] = htmlspecialchars($incoming_comment['comment_content']);
    	$incoming_comment['comment_content'] = str_replace( "'", ''', $incoming_comment['comment_content'] );
    	return( $incoming_comment );
    }
    
    function plc_comment_display( $comment_to_display ) {
    	$comment_to_display = str_replace( ''', "'", $comment_to_display );
    	return $comment_to_display;
    }
    add_filter( 'preprocess_comment', 'plc_comment_post', '', 1);
    add_filter( 'comment_text', 'plc_comment_display', '', 1);
    add_filter( 'comment_text_rss', 'plc_comment_display', '', 1);
    add_filter( 'comment_excerpt', 'plc_comment_display', '', 1);
    //html в комментариях end

    Но при этом если вбить урл (без тегов) — то он станет активным

    Есть ли альтернативы данного способа (плагины и т.п.), которые бы урлы не делали активными?

Просмотр 3 ответов — с 1 по 3 (всего 3)
Просмотр 3 ответов — с 1 по 3 (всего 3)
  • Тема «Как отлючить HTML теги в комментариях» закрыта для новых ответов.